Operators 103

The Operating Engineers have played an important role in bringing our area into the new energy saving innovations with their involvement in the wind farms in Benton and White counties. These phases have included the Fowler Ridge Wind Farm Phase II, Hoosier Wind Farm and the Meadow Lake Wind Farm Phases I & II.

Road work has included State Road 26 East and upgrades on County Road 350 South. The local has also worked at the new St. Elizabeth Regional Health Center in Lafayette.

Local 103 accepts about 50 apprentices each year for its 6,000-hour training program that includes nomenclature, safety, blueprint reading, welding and more. Upgrade journeyman training is also offered on an ongoing basis.

Members of Local 103 generally contribute time to Habitat for Humanity.

Established: 1902                           
Members: 3,400
Indiana counties served: 33
Membership benefits: Employment opportunities, overtime pay, health and hospitalization plan, pension/retirement plan.
National association: International Union of Operating Engineers.
